The new road transport advisory group will be established to advise the Fair Work Commission in relation to matters that involve the road transport industry. The minister will appoint the road transport advisory group members who must be members of or nominated by registered organisations entitled to represent the interests of road transport contractors or road transport businesses. The road transport advisory group may form subcommittees which may include people with appropriate expertise or experience who are not appointed to the road transport advisory group. This approach allows for additional expertise to be brought in as required—for example, where a proposed order will cover different types of road transport work. So it's the role of the minister to appoint people to the road transport advisory group. As for their continued membership, that's a matter for the minister, and I think you referred to the fact that clause 40F(4) allows the minister to revoke a person's appointment to the road transport advisory group.
